Nintendo QA Manager Salaries in Seattle

The average Nintendo QA Manager in Seattle earns an estimated $129,075 annually. Nintendo's QA Manager compensation is $11,197 more than the US average for a QA Manager.

In Seattle, The Engineering Department at Nintendo earns $5,358 more on average than the Operations Department.

QA Manager Compensation by Gender (All Companies)

The average female QA Manager at companies similar size to Nintendo reported making $123,417, while the average male QA Manager at similar sized companies reported making $138,334.

QA Manager Compensation by Ethnicity (All Companies)

The average Asian or Pacific Islander QA Manager at companies similar size to Nintendo reported making $155,000, while the average Hispanic or Latino QA Manager at similar sized companies reported making $96,500.
